Termo :: Conclusão.

Leia uma linha de entrada do usuário, com funções de conveniência
Baixe Agora

Termo :: Conclusão.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• Perl Artistic License
  • Preço:
  • FREE
  • Nome do editor:
  • Marek Rouchal
  • Site do editor:
  • http://search.cpan.org/~marekr/

Termo :: Conclusão. Tag


Termo :: Conclusão. Descrição

Leia uma linha de entrada do usuário, com funções de conveniência Termo :: Conclusão é uma substituição extensível e altamente configurável para o prazo venerável :: pacote completo. Este módulo é orientado para objetos e, portanto, permite a subclassificação. Duas classes derivadas são termo :: Conclusão :: Multi e Term :: Conclusão :: Caminho. Um prompt é impresso e o usuário pode inserir uma linha de entrada, enviando a resposta pressionando a tecla ENTER. Este cenário básico pode ser implementado assim: minha resposta de $ = ; Chomp $ Resposta; Mas muitas vezes você não quer que o usuário digite a palavra completa (de uma lista de opções), mas permita a conclusão, isto é, expansão da palavra, tanto quanto possível, pressionando apenas as teclas necessárias. Alguns usuários gostam de percorrer as escolhas, de preferência com as teclas de seta para cima / baixo. E, finalmente, você pode não querer que o usuário insira quaisquer caracteres aleatórios, mas valide o que foi enter e voltar se a entrada não passar a validação. Se você está faltando edição de linha completa (esquerda / direita, excluir para a esquerda e para a direita, pule para o começo e o final, etc.), você provavelmente está errado aqui, e deseja considerar o termo :: Readline e Amigos. :: Conclusão; Meu $ TC = termo :: Conclusão-> Novo (Prompt => "Digite seu primeiro nome:", opções => ; meu nome $ = $ tc-> completo (); Imprimir "Você inseriu: $ NAME "; Requisitos: · Perl.


Termo :: Conclusão. Software Relacionado